[1] : The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
cachinnation \cach`inna"tion\ ka^k`i^nn=a"shu^n, n.
   l. cachinnatio, fr. cachinnare to laugh aloud, cf. gr.
   kacha`zein.
   loud or immoderate laughter; -- often a symptom of hysterical
   or maniacal affections.
   1913 webster

         hideous grimaces . . . attended this unusual
         cachinnation.                            --sir w.
                                                  scott.
   1913 webster

[2] : WordNet (r) 2.0
cachinnation
     n : loud convulsive laughter
